Take a look at the chart below. These are statistics from the federal government. They show clearly that every time you increase your educational level, your earning potential also increases! Compare "High school diploma" to "Bachelor's degree" (that's a four- year college degree). The difference is $524 a week, $27,248 in a year, and $817,440 in a typical 30 year career!!! That's right, you will earn over 3/4 of a million dollars more (in this example) by getting educational training beyond high school.
Now, take a look at the unemployment rates too. Not only do you earn more money, but you also have a much lower chance of losing your job!
